The foundations for Villa number 2 have been dug. Now all the hard work starts. We spent last week desperately trying to finish the steps on Villa 1 and marking out where exactly we wanted Villa 2 to sit on the land. Thank god we were on the ball because the digger man arrived Friday instead of Saturday - just as I was pulling the last marker out of the soil. Good timing or what ?
The next job is to get all the metalwork into the trenches and the concrete poured - Before it rains. The last time we dug trenches it rained for 2 weeks solid and Bryan had to bail out by hand - not a job to relish !! The forecast is good for the foreseeable future so fingers crossed.
We have been busy in the garden too. The Onions and Garlic are planted and also Beetroot, Radish, Spring Onions & Green Beans. The potatoes are next to go in in a couple of weeks and my Tomato seeds are sown & sat on the bathroom windowsill where they get the early morning sunshine.
